Hallmark Movie 'Christmas Incorporated' Premieres Tonight, Stars Shenae Grimes-Beech and Steve Lund

Christmas Incorporated premieres November 15 on Hallmark Channel. Photo Credit: Copyright 2015 Crown Media United States, LLC/Photographer: Ben Mark Holzberg
Hallmark Original Movie Christmas Incorporated premieres Sunday, November 15 at 8 p.m. ET/PT on Hallmark Channel. The holiday film stars Shenae Grimes-Beech and Steve Lund.

When Riley Vance (Grimes-Beech) is hired as a personal assistant after a case of mistaken identity, she keeps the truth a secret so she can help her boss William Young (Lund) save a town at risk of losing their main livelihood just before Christmas even as she gets closer to William.

Hallmark Movie 'Best Christmas Party Ever' Premieres Tonight, Stars Torrey DeVitto, Steve Lund

Best Christmas Party Ever premieres December 13 on Hallmark Channel. Photo Credit: Copyright
2014 Crown Media United States, LLC/Photographer:Christos Kalohoridis
Hallmark Channel Original Movie Best Christmas Party Ever premieres on Saturday, December 13 at 8 p.m. ET/PT. The film stars Torrey DeVitto (Pretty Little Liars) and Steve Lund (Bitten), Linda Thorson (The Avengers) and Harmon Walsh (Saving Hope).

With Christmas approaching, young party planner Jennie Stanton (DeVitto) learns that her boss, Petra (Thorson), will be retiring after Christmas and hopes she will be left in charge of Petra's Parties, New York's premiere event planning service. Jennie's hopes fade when Petra's charming and handsome nephew, Nick (Lund), arrives on the scene and Petra announces that he will take over the business. To make matters worse, Jennie and Nick do not get along. When an opportunity to plan a toy store's Christmas Eve party arises, Jennie runs with it, arranging a warm and traditional affair in the same vein as the Christmas parties that inspired her as a child.
